M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. 2015 – Routledge.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
book
that
addresses
issues
relating to open
education resources
and
massive open online courses (MOOCs).
Modern
gains in
distance learning technology have made it possible for
people
in every nation on earth
to participate in courses via the Internet.
MOOC courses are
ordinarily free
for students but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
